文档中心 > API类目 > yunos推送服务api

yunos.service.cmns.coa.device.get (设备详情查询)

第三方应用开发者调用此接口查询设备详情

公共参数

请求参数

名称 类型 是否必须 示例值 更多限制 描述
type String 可选 uuid 设备id类型,可以是uuid,imei,deviceToken,kp
value String 可选 uuid 设备id

响应参数

名称 类型 示例值 描述
device_list DeviceResult [] 设备详情 设备详情
  • └ accept_message
  • Number
  • 1
  • 是否接收消息
  • └ active_time
  • Date
  • 2020-04-17 11:06:24
  • 激活时间
  • └ base_type
  • String
  • 基带
  • 基带
  • └ bsp_type
  • String
  • BSP
  • BSP
  • └ device_type
  • Number
  • 1
  • 设备类型:1手机 2TV
  • └ eth_mac
  • String
  • 72:a6:11:2c:60:43
  • 有线网卡mac
  • └ id
  • Number
  • did
  • did
  • └ imei
  • String
  • imei
  • imei
  • └ imsi1
  • String
  • imsi1
  • imsi1
  • └ imsi2
  • String
  • imsi2
  • imsi2
  • └ is_vendor_rom
  • String
  • isVendorRom
  • isVendorRom
  • └ kp
  • String
  • 2143242412341
  • kp
  • └ login_time
  • Number
  • 2020-04-17 11:06:24
  • 最近登录时间
  • └ networking
  • String
  • ETHERNET
  • 网络类型
  • └ online
  • Number
  • 1
  • 是否在线,1为在线,0为离线
  • └ phone_type
  • String
  • 内部机型
  • phoneType
  • └ rom
  • String
  • aaa
  • 系统版本
  • └ rom_tuiguang
  • String
  • romTuiguang
  • romTuiguang
  • └ rom_vendor
  • String
  • romVendor
  • romVendor
  • └ terminal
  • String
  • 设备机型
  • 设备机型
  • └ update_version
  • String
  • 轻量升级版本
  • 轻量升级版本
  • └ uuid
  • String
  • uuid
  • uuid
  • └ wlan_mac
  • String
  • 72:a6:11:2c:60:43
  • 无线mac
message String SUCCESS 接口查询出错提示信息
status Number 200 200表示查询成功

请求示例

  • JAVA
  • .NET
  • PHP
  • CURL
  • Python
  • C/C++
  • NodeJS
TaobaoClient client = new DefaultTaobaoClient(url, appkey, secret);
YunosServiceCmnsCoaDeviceGetRequest req = new YunosServiceCmnsCoaDeviceGetRequest();
req.setType("uuid");
req.setValue("uuid");
YunosServiceCmnsCoaDeviceGetResponse rsp = client.execute(req);
System.out.println(rsp.getBody());

响应示例

  • XML示例
  • JSON示例
<yunos_service_cmns_coa_device_get_response>
    <device_list>
        <device_result>
            <accept_message>1</accept_message>
            <active_time>2020-04-17 11:06:24</active_time>
            <base_type>基带</base_type>
            <bsp_type>BSP</bsp_type>
            <device_type>1</device_type>
            <eth_mac>72:a6:11:2c:60:43</eth_mac>
            <id>did</id>
            <imei>imei</imei>
            <imsi1>imsi1</imsi1>
            <imsi2>imsi2</imsi2>
            <is_vendor_rom>isVendorRom</is_vendor_rom>
            <kp>2143242412341</kp>
            <login_time>2020-04-17 11:06:24</login_time>
            <networking>ETHERNET</networking>
            <online>1</online>
            <phone_type>内部机型</phone_type>
            <rom>aaa</rom>
            <rom_tuiguang>romTuiguang</rom_tuiguang>
            <rom_vendor>romVendor</rom_vendor>
            <terminal>设备机型</terminal>
            <update_version>轻量升级版本</update_version>
            <uuid>uuid</uuid>
            <wlan_mac>72:a6:11:2c:60:43</wlan_mac>
        </device_result>
    </device_list>
    <message>SUCCESS</message>
    <status>200</status>
</yunos_service_cmns_coa_device_get_response>

异常示例

  • XML示例
  • JSON示例
<error_response>
    <code>50</code>
    <msg>Remote service error</msg>
    <sub_code>isv.invalid-parameter</sub_code>
    <sub_msg>非法参数</sub_msg>
</error_response>

错误码解释

错误码 错误描述 解决方案

API工具

如何获得此API

FAQ

返回
顶部